Siamese Jovana Rikalo/Stocksy United. Popular since the 19th century, this breed of cat originated in Thailand (formerly known as Siam). The Siamese has helped create many other breeds, including the Oriental Shorthair, Sphynx, and Himalayan.

The root of the mythical Chinese Hairless cat might be Monsieur Patrick Challan, a French antique breeder who apparently attempted to revive hairless cats as a breed (undated report). He speculated that his cats were Sphynx cats, which lived in China in ancient times and which were descended from a liaison between a cat and a "beautiful midget hairless dog".

Hairlessness in cats is a naturally occurring genetic mutation; however, the Sphynx cat, as a breed, was developed through selective breeding, starting in the 1960s. Some hairless cat breeds (for example, the Donskoy and Peterbald) have a handful of coat types that give the slightest hint of fur (from rubber bald to flocked and brush to velour), but the Sphynx, Bambino and Ukrainian Levkoy are covered in a fine, downy fuzz, making them feel like suede. Sphynx and Rex breeds are the most unusual looking in the world of cats. Rex, who are divided into the Cornish and Devon varieties, have short, wavy coats with no overcoat layer of fur. Sphynx are known for their “nakedness”, though have degrees of hairlessness. Both breeds are known for their extremely social, friendly personalities.

The first Persian cat was presented at the first organized cat show, in 1871 in the Crystal Palace in London, England, organized by Harrison Weir. As specimens closer to the later established Persian conformation became the more popular types, attempts were made to differentiate it from the Angora.

The Persian is an ancient breed of cat and, as with other ancient breeds, her history is a bit clouded. Longhaired cats were in Italy in the 1500s. These cats were imported from Asia. In the 17th century, Pietro della Valle brought a cat from Persia to Italy to add to the breeding program.

Persians have always been bred to have a round head, short face, snub nose, chubby cheeks and a short, cobby body, but over time those features have become exaggerated. The Persian is the most popular pedigreed cat in North America, if not the world. He first came into vogue during the Victorian era, but he existed long before then.

The Turkish Angora is an ancient and natural breed of cats that originate in the Ankara region of Turkey. It’s a wide belief that the mutation for a white coat and long hair came from this breed dating back to the 17 th century.. Turkish Angora cats have long, silky coats and elegant bodies.

The Turkish Angora’s soft, silky coat rarely mats and requires only minimal grooming. In the 1950s, at the Ankara Zoo, the Turkish Angora was discovered by American servicemen and re-introduced to the cat fancy. All Turkish Angoras registered by CFA must be able to trace their ancestry back to Turkey.

The crossed eyes of the Siamese cat developed naturally to compensate for a genetic flaw in their eye structure. Interestingly, this same genetic trait causes the coloration of Siamese. Although the cat's eyes are not permanently crossed, traditional Siamese cats must cross them to see straight.

Siamese cats are often born "cross-eyed," with both eyes affected by strabismus and pointing inward at the nose, or convergent strabismus. When both eyes are affected and point outward, it is categorized as divergent. This condition can be apparent at birth or it may develop later in life in felines.

Crossed eyes may appear at birth but can also develop later in life. Cats who are born with a convergent strabismus generally adjust to the condition on their own and enjoy a good quality of life. Cross-eyed cats are just like any other cats. Their eyes do not affect their qualify of life. In the past, crossed eyes seemed to occur more commonly in Siamese cats due to selective breeding. This is far less common today. A small percentage of cross-eyed cats may be the result of nerve damage in the eye muscles.
